Definition
The'' Traffic Engineering Handbook ''describes "Arterials" as being either principal or minor. Both classes serve to carry longer-distance flows between important centers of activity. The handbook also states that arterials are laid out as the backbone of a traffic network and ''should'' be designed to afford the highest
level of service, as is practical.

Specifications
In North America,
signalized at-grade intersection
An intersection or an at-grade junction is a junction where two or more roads converge, diverge, meet or cross at the same height, as opposed to an interchange, which uses bridges or tunnels to separate different roads. Major intersections ar ...
s are used to connect arterials to collector roads and other local roads (except where the intersecting road is a minor side street, in which case a
stop sign
A stop sign is a traffic sign designed to notify drivers that they must come to a complete stop and make sure the intersection (road), intersection (or level crossing, railroad crossing) is safely clear of vehicles and pedestrians before contin ...
is used instead). In Europe, large roundabouts are more commonly seen at the busier junctions. Speed limits are typically between , depending on the density of use of the surrounding development. In school zones, speeds may be further reduced; likewise, in sparsely developed or rural areas, speeds may be increased. In western Canada, where highways are scarce compared to the rest of North America, flashing early-warning amber lights are sometimes placed ahead of traffic lights on heavy signalized arterial roads so the speed limits can be raised to speeds of over 80 km/h. These warning lights are commonly found on high-speed arterial roads in British Columbia.
The width of arterial roads ranges from four lanes to ten or more.
